Graduation GC Holder

This is actually a gift card holder. I have plans on slipping in money however! The size is 4-1/4″ by 8-1/2″ with scores at 3″ and 2-1/2″ leaving me a card of 5-1/2″ x 4-1/4″. The 2-1/2″ panel was folded up and taped down on the sides to make a pocket to hold the money (or gift card). The hippo was colored with Copic Markers and then cut out using Nestabilities. (I’ve gotten rid of all my Marvy punches now – love these nesties!) By the way, the top flap folds down and is tied in place with the ribbon that wraps around the card.
